At HI Flyers, we recognize and appreciate the fact that your children have spent their day in a structured environment. That is why we are pleased to offer a relaxed and fun environment for the students of Holy Innocents’ Episcopal School.
HI Flyers is open from 12:00pm-6:00pm and coordinates closings in accordance to the school calendar. Our program is available for Early Learner to Fifth-grade students. We provide time for our students to engage in age appropriate activities such as art projects, explorers, outdoor free time, and creative indoor board games. We also provide a time and space for students to work on homework as specified by their parents. Our well-trained and talented staff provides a variety of knowledge and experience that enhances our program.
At HI Flyers, students may be registered to be a Regular Attendee or a Drop-In student. The drop in program is based on availability and is typically only offered to Lower School students. Rates are found on the registration forms or in our brochure, both of which can be downloaded from this page. Regular Attendees are billed once a month. Drop-in fees are paid upon time of service. All three forms must be filled out completely and an $80.00 registration fee, made out to HIES, included in order to activate the registration process. Completed Registration Forms must be turned in at the HI Flyers office, located in the Parish Hall, Room 106. Enrollment is ongoing throughout the school year, space permitting. Students are registered on a first come, first serve basis.
Frequently asked questions:
Q- What grades can register for HI Flyers?
A-HI Flyers accepts Early Learners through Fifth Grade.
Q- What kind of activities do my children participate in daily?
A- Each age group has a different schedule. Children are offered a daily art project, explorer (teacher lead group activities), outdoor free play, homework time, rest time(Early Learners), and a variety of age appropriate toys/board games.
Q - How are we billed for the HI Flyers program?
A - All billing is handled by the bookkeeping department. Billing is done monthly and bills are due upon receipt. The HI Flyers office accepts checks for the registration fee and for registered Drop In students.
Q- How quickly does the program fill up? Is there going to be space for my child to register in HI Flyers?
A- HI Flyers students are registered on a first come, first serve basis. There is limited space for Early Learners, Pre-Kindergarten and Kindergarten. There is always availability for Lower School students.
Q - I registered my child in the HI Flyers program now what?
A - You should expect a registration confirmation and parent guide in the mail. The HI Flyers program begins after dismissal on the first FULL day of school for each child. We cannot take children before their regularly scheduled HI Flyers time if they are in Kindergarten and have early dismissal during the first two weeks of school. Our well trained staff will pick up your little ones from their classes and bring them to our program located here in the Parish Hall building of the Lower School. Parents should provide a lunch for their child. Please remember that we are a "peanut aware" school, and therefore encourage parents to make sure their child's lunch does not contain nut products. We cannot heat lunches.
Q - Where do I pick up my child?
A - Authorized persons must sign out their HI Flyers at the front desk located in the Parish Hall building of the Lower School. Please be prepared to show a picture I.D. Persons under the age of 18 are not permitted to pick up a student from HI Flyers.
Q - I registered my child for HI Flyers but now I need to change my schedule or cancel. How do I do this?
A -Parents are welcome to change their schedule for HI Flyers, but schedule changes can only be made to go into effect on the 1st of the month. There is $25 fee from the billing office for each schedule change after the end of September, and the billing office cannot prorate a child's bill.
Q- Is HI Flyers open even if the school is closed?
A- HI Flyers is closed on days when there is no school or when the Lower School is closed or has noon dismissal. On days when there are special events at the Pre-School, children may get out of school early. On these days HI Flyers is not able to accept students before their regularly scheduled start time.
